  • Patent number: 8817024
    Abstract: A display device includes a display panel for displaying an instrument image including an index image constituting an index and a pointer image constituting a pointer for pointing the index of the index image and a controller for displaying the instrument image on the display panel. The controller varies at least one of a pointer display mode of the pointer image and an index display mode of the index image so as to increase a readability of the index indicated by the index image when positions associated with the pointer image and the index image coincide.

  • Patent number: 8279141
    Abstract: A display device includes a display panel having a plurality of pixels in a form of matrix and a controller configured to control the plurality of pixels of the display panel so that an instrument image indicating an instrument is displayed on the display panel. The instrument image includes a scale image indicating a scale, and a pointer image indicating a pointer that is movable in accordance with an increase and decrease in a measured magnitude for indicating the measured magnitude in association with the scale image. The instrument image further includes a highlight image that is displayed in a predetermined pattern in accordance with at least one of a position and a motion of the pointer image.

  • Patent number: 5211128
    Abstract: An automobile meter device of the type having a self-acting light-emitting needle or pointer is disclosed in which first and second current supply terminals connected with first and second electrodes of a light-emitting element are disposed on opposite side of a pointer boss. The current supply terminals include plug-in sockets extending parallel to a longitudinal axis of the pointer shaft. When the pointer boss is fitted over a meter shaft to assemble the pointer with a pointer drive unit, the sockets are automatically fitted over connector pins of fourth current supply terminals which are connected with a power source. With this construction, the meter can be assembled efficiently with utmost ease. The pointer boss may be electrically conductive and connected with one of the electrodes of the light-emitting element in which instance one of the current supply terminals may be omitted.
